I am a beginner in the world of FPGA design and I need to make a sinusoidal modulation pwm multilevel Inverter (area of power electronics), basically what I need to know how to generate a sine wave and also a triangular wave. What is the easiest way? ... I have seen some documents speak of using algorithms Cordic use or look up table, but do not address the problem as well. Basic methods for sine ROM tables have been discussed e. g. in this thread http://www.alteraforum.com/forum/showthread.php?t=1902& This is, what I regard as the easiest way, I have used it with RF applications (digital receiver PLL) as well as 16.7/50 Hz power electronics. The other options you mentioned, are feasible ways too, also Altera NCO compiler.
Triangle waveforms can be generated easily by an up/down counter and some additional logic.- Mark as New
